Transmission speed clarification please

I have some Puch's. My Maxi and Pinto have what I would call a 2 speed tranny and my Magnum has what I would call a 3 speed tranny.

I never see any talk about a 3 speed tranny - only 1 speed and 2 speed. Could someone set me straight on my understanding on what people are referring to when they talk trannys?

The Maxi and Pinto -E50- have only 1 shift point so it has 2 gears in it. Is this referred to as a single speed tranny because it only shifts once? I would call it a 2 speed.

The Magnum- ZA50- has 2 shift points so it has 3 gears in it. Is this referred to as a two speed tranny because it shifts twice? I would call it a 3 speed.

Your E50's have one gear ratio and your Za50 has two. They both have automatic clutches though, so when the clutch finally engages it may sound like its "shifting".

what you think is a shift point is actually your clutch fully engaging.

Re: Transmission speed clarification please

yeah, your e50 does not shift at all, and your za50 only shifts once.
